Curriculum & learning
C
"While there are examples of good planning practices, more consistent connection to assessment is needed to fully understand and support tamariki progress. Evidence of learning over time is not well documented, and discussions about the quality of the programme and improvements are not recorded."

Assessment and planning practices inconsistent; learning documentation lacking; programme quality discussions not record

Bicultural practice
A
"Tamariki thrive in an environment where mātauranga Māori and iwi values shape their learning. Daily karakia held in a central space supports wairuatanga and sets a positive tone for the day. Clear and embedded routines allow tamariki to participate in karakia, waiata, rotarota, and kōrero tuku iho, which reflect the stories and values of their whānau, hapū, and iwi."

Mātauranga Māori embedded throughout; daily tikanga practices; iwi-led governance; strong cultural identity focus.
